>In that case it would seem likely that it could be fixed by reverting to >C-style cast, no? I've seen in the CVS that the casts are to support enums. But the documentation for integral_c says An Integral Constant is a class (or a template class) that represents a value of a built-in integral type Enumerations are not integral types. Also, the presence of next and prior exposes the use with enumerators to undefined behavior. Do we really want that?
